Transaction 25fc62493a678675ddce17f14f697deb9118c8994d1e2771e2cce536804c69a6
1 Input
1 Output
-
25fc62493a678675ddce17f14f697deb9118c8994d1e2771e2cce536804c69a6:0
- value
- 17317
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d7ff56151d6421b5d816f8ba360166db3803ce0
- address
- bc1qt4ll2c236eppkhvpd796xcqkdkecq08qhuwt5t